QT--------QLineEdit
来源:互联网 发布:2017最新一手数据 编辑:程序博客网 时间:2024/06/05 03:59
#include<QApplication>#include<QLineEdit>#include<QCompleter>int main(int argc,char* argv[]){ QApplication app(argc,argv);//1 QWidget w;//2 构造一个窗口 w.setWindowTitle("Hello World!");//设置窗口标题 QLineEdit edit; edit.show(); edit.setParent(&w); /*输入密码*/ //显示输入密码的样子LineEdit有四种显示模式 //Normal NoEcho PassWord PasswordEchoOnEdit //edit.setEchoMode(QLineEdit::Password);//1 //edit.text(); //edit.setEchoMode(QLineEdit::NoEcho);//2 //edit.setEchoMode(QLineEdit::PasswordEchoOnEdit);//3 /*输入密码提示*/ //edit.setPlaceholderText("Please input text"); /*补全*/ QCompleter completer(QStringList() << "aab"<< "1122" << "998"); //completer.setFilterMode(Qt::MatchContains);有错误 edit.setCompleter(&completer); w.show();//3默认情况下隐藏,需要用show显示出来 /*发送信号的对象 发送对象 接收信号的对象 要执行的槽*/ //QObject::connect(&button,SIGNAL(clicked()),&w,SLOT(close())); return app.exec();//4}
0 0
- QT--------QLineEdit
- Qt::QLineEdit
- Qt中QLineEdit切换
- Qt 之 QLineEdit
- QT——QLineEdit
- qt 之 QLineEdit
- Qt之QLineEdit
- Qt之QLineEdit
- Qt:QLineEdit 无法输入
- Qt常用类QLineEdit
- Qt 之 QLineEdit 和 QRegExp
- Qt入门-QLineEdit::setInputMask()
- Qt入门-QLineEdit::setInputMask()
- Qt/project1/QPushButton/QLineEdit/QPlainTextEdit
- QT QLineEdit背景文字提示
- qt学习笔记之QLineEdit
- QT之qss教程-QLineEdit
- QLineEdit
- 【LeetCode】17. Letter Combinations of a Phone Number
- 分页内存和非分页内存区别
- 解决Linux 启动 Nginx报错 :nginx: [emerg] mkdir() "/var/temp/nginx/client" failed (2: No such file or direc
- storm分布式安装
- SSH用通用dao更新出现的问题
- QT--------QLineEdit
- 【程序9】输出国际象棋棋盘
- Ubuntu 16.04 LTS 中通过grub修改root用户密码
- Oracle PL/SQL开发入门(第一弹:Oracle 11g数据库系统)
- Java IO 系列源码分析——ByteArrayInputStream和ByteArrayOutputStream
- 关于linux驱动管理笔记
- 一位资深程序员大牛给予Java初学者的学习建议
- thinking in java——0320学习笔记
- 性能优化三 使用索引的注意事项